function eventAjaxGetEmailTemplateText(Eventcontroler $evtcl) { if ($evtcl->temlid != '') { $do_user_email_tmpl = new EmailTemplateUser(); $do_user_email_tmpl->getId($evtcl->temlid); $evtcl->addOutputValue($do_user_email_tmpl->bodyhtml); } }
function getEmailTemplateList() { $user_email_templates = new EmailTemplateUser("blank"); $user_email_templates->getUserSavedEmailTemplates(); $output = ''; if ($user_email_templates->getNumRows()) { $count = 0; while ($user_email_templates->next()) { $e_remove_etml = new Event("do_user_email_teml->eventDeleteUserEmailTmpl"); $e_remove_etml->addParam('id', $user_email_templates->idemailtemplate_user); $e_remove_etml->addParam("goto", $_SERVER['PHP_SELF']); $count++; $output .= '<div id="templt' . $count . '" class="co_worker_item co_worker_desc">'; $output .= '<div style="position: relative;">'; $output .= '<a href="' . $GLOBALS['cfg_plugin_mkt_path'] . 'MEmailTemplate/' . $user_email_templates->idemailtemplate_user . '">' . $user_email_templates->name . '</a>'; $img_del = '<img src="/images/delete.gif" width="14px" height="14px" alt="Delete" />'; $output .= '<div width="15px" id="trashcan' . $count . '" class="deletenote" style="right:0;">' . $e_remove_etml->getLink($img_del, ' title="' . _('Delete') . '"') . '</div>'; $output .= '</div></div>'; } } else { $this->setIsActive(false); } return $output; }
$("#unsaved_draft").hide("slow"); } }); } // Run the save draft method in every 30 seconds window.setInterval("fnSaveDraft()", 30000); $(document).ready(function() {; //$("#editor_bodyhtml_iframe").css("height","80px"); }); //]]> </script> <?php echo _('Select an email template'); echo '<form id="select_email_template"><select name="idtemplate" onchange=\'$("#select_email_template").submit();\'><option value="0"></option><option value="0">' . _('New Template') . '</option>'; $template_list = new EmailTemplateUser(); $template_list->query('SELECT * FROM ' . $template_list->getTable() . ' WHERE iduser='******'do_User']->iduser . ' AND name <> \'\''); while ($template_list->next()) { echo '<option value="' . $template_list->getPrimaryKeyValue() . '">' . $template_list->name . '</option>'; } ?> </select> </form><a href=""><?php echo _('Manage your templates'); ?> </a><br /> <?php echo _('Insert a merge field'); ?> <form id="select_merge_field"> <select name="merge_fields" onchange="fnInsertMergeField(this)">
$Author = 'SQLFusion LLC'; $Keywords = 'Keywords for search engine'; $Description = 'Description for search engine'; $background_color = 'white'; include_once 'config.php'; include_once 'includes/ofuz_check_access.script.inc.php'; include_once 'includes/header.inc.php'; $do_auto_responder = new AutoResponder(); //$do_auto_responder->sessionPersistent('do_auto_responder', 'contacts.php', OFUZ_TTL); //$user_email_templ = new EmailTemplateUser(); $access = true; if (isset($_GET['id']) && $_GET['id'] != '') { $do_auto_responder_email = new AutoResponderEmail(); $do_auto_responder_email->getId($_GET['id']); $do_auto_responder_email->sessionPersistent('do_auto_responder_email', 'contacts.php', OFUZ_TTL); $user_email_templ = new EmailTemplateUser(); $do_auto_responder = new AutoResponder(); $idautoresponder = $_SESSION['do_auto_responder_email']->idautoresponder; if (!$do_auto_responder->isOwner($_SESSION['do_auto_responder_email']->idautoresponder)) { $access = false; } $do_auto_responder->getId($_SESSION['do_auto_responder_email']->idautoresponder); } else { $access = false; } ?> <script type="text/javascript"> //<![CDATA[ $(document).ready(function() { $("div[id^=templt]").hover(function(){$("div[id^=trashcan]",this).show("slow");},function(){$("div[id^=trashcan]",this).hide("slow");}); });
<?php /**COPYRIGHTS**/ // Copyright 2008 - 2010 all rights reserved, SQLFusion LLC, info@sqlfusion.com /**COPYRIGHTS**/ $do_user_email_teml = new EmailTemplateUser("blank"); $emtpl_access = true; $do_user_email_teml->sessionPersistent('do_user_email_teml', 'contacts.php', OFUZ_TTL); if (isset($plugin_item_value)) { $idtemplate = $plugin_item_value; if (!$_SESSION['do_user_email_teml']->isTemplateOwner($idtemplate)) { $emtpl_access = false; } } ?> <script type="text/javascript"> //<![CDATA[ $(document).ready(function() { $("div[id^=templt]").hover(function(){$("div[id^=trashcan]",this).show("slow");},function(){$("div[id^=trashcan]",this).hide("slow");}); }); function fnInsertMergeField(merge){ if (merge.selectedIndex > 0) { var mergefield = merge[merge.selectedIndex].value; var textarea = dijit.byId("editor_bodyhtml"); textarea.attr("value", textarea.attr("value")+mergefield); merge.selectedIndex = 0; } } //]]> </script>